Breaks and Lunch Breaks. A 30 or 60 minute unpaid lunch shall be given to all full-time employees. Employees may negotiate scheduling and duration of their lunch breaks with the supervisor. For every four hours worked, an employee receives a 15 minute paid break to be scheduled with the supervisor. Full-time employees shall be entitled to a 15 minute paid break for each 4 hours worked which may be combined for a one-half (1/2) hour paid lunch at the employee's option with the agreement of the supervisor. These breaks shall be duty free unless agreed to otherwise by the union and the employee. Notwithstanding the above, certain jobs may require the employee's continued presence during lunch period and breaks.
